Further cleanup of ReorderBufferCommit().
2015年1月26日 03:49:56 +0000 (22:49 -0500)
2015年1月26日 03:49:56 +0000 (22:49 -0500)
On closer inspection, we can remove the "volatile" qualifier on
"using_subtxn" so long as we initialize that before the PG_TRY block,
which there's no particularly good reason not to do.
Also, push the "change" variable inside the PG_TRY so as to remove
all question of whether it needs "volatile", and remove useless
early initializations of "snapshow_now" and "using_subtxn".

+ /*
+ * Decoding needs access to syscaches et al., which in turn use
+ * heavyweight locks and such. Thus we need to have enough state around to
+ * keep track of those. The easiest way is to simply use a transaction
+ * internally. That also allows us to easily enforce that nothing writes
+ * to the database by checking for xid assignments.
+ *
+ * When we're called via the SQL SRF there's already a transaction
+ * started, so start an explicit subtransaction there.
+ */
